A chord of a circle is the hypotenuse of an isosceles right triangle whose legs are theradii of the circle. The radius of the circle is 6 √ 2. What is the area of the circle ?

Area = rxrxπ

A = 6 √ 2 x 6 √ 2 π

A = 36 x 2 π = 72π
